The Federal Government says it saved N1.7tn from 2009 to 2022 by clogging loopholes in its procurement process. The acting Director-General of the Bureau of Public Procurement, Olusegun Omotola, revealed this in a presentation when the Chief of Staff to the President, Mr Femi Gbajabiamila, embarked on a one-day fact-finding tour of some government agencies
